Approximately ten months ago right around the time that tony’s wife passed away, he developed ear pain that wouldn’t go away, it was so persistent and painful and nobody would listen to him. He then developed a cough about a week after that and it just wouldn’t go away. He went to urgent care after urgent care and could not get anyone to listen and take him seriously. They all thought he was having anxiety and not sleeping well due to the death of his wife. He complained about a sore throat and they all chalked it up to him crying and screaming at night because he felt so alone and lost. The months came and went and all they could say was to go home and take some melatonin and sleep it off. They said that his lungs were clear and his throat looked fine. He finally had a routine visit to the Dr. in March when his daughter, Michelle, accompanied him to demand answers and demand he see an ENT to figure out this ear pain, the cough and the reason why it sounded as if he couldn’t breathe anymore on his own. He was very winded all the time and constantly sounded like he was whistling just to talk. They went to the Dr. and Michelle asked the secretary to hand her a piece of paper so she could write her a note… on that note it stated, “my Dad cannot breathe but he will refuse to go to the hospital unless the Dr tells him he has to.” The Dr. walked in and said, I can hear you breathing from outside, your lungs sound like junk! He listened to his lungs and his breathing and said it doesn’t sound good at all. Michelle begged for an ENT referral and he agreed to send them. They gave him an inhaler and said check back in two weeks. They went to check out and they said ENT would call them! Michelle refused to wait and she marched right over there to the ENT and said that he needed to be seen ASAP. They were able to get an appointment two days later. Fast forward two days to one of the worst days of his life. The ENT did a scope and pulled the scope out and said, “I don’t even have to do a biopsy, you have cancer” then stated that “you need to get to the hospital to have an emergency tracheotomy put in to save your airway from collapsing!” They rushed to the hospital on March 6th, had a tracheotomy by the wee morning hours of March 7th. One cough or sneeze and this man would’ve been dead. March 13th he was allowed to go home for a few days before the major surgery on the 20th however he did not make it at home before they had to call 911 twice due to choking on blood clots. He was rushed back in by ambulance on the 18th and readmitted to the hospital. March, 20th they did the major surgery which took hours and hours only to be rushed back in less than 24hrs later for an emergency surgery to remove four blood clots. During the major surgery they removed his voice box as well as four lymph nodes and removed some of the muscle from under his arm to graph it into his throat to create a flap. This created hundreds of sutures inside and outside only to be replaced by staples when he went back in for the emergency surgery.
